What is a personal brand?

A personal brand is simply how you appear to others when they think of you – it’s your reputation and how you present yourself, both online and offline. Similar to a business, you need to think about how you want people to view you, and what kind of message you want to convey. For example, if you are a creative professional, you might want to come across as edgy and innovative. Whereas if you are a business professional, you might want to focus on being competent and reliable while demonstrating your expertise. WiseStamp

WiseStamp is an email signature generator that can be used to create custom HTML signatures for all your outgoing emails. It allows you to easily add links to your social media accounts and website, as well as custom images, logos, and even taglines to really make your emails stand out. With email still being one of the most powerful communication tools on the planet, it’s well worth taking the time to create a professional email signature so that everyone you communicate with, both inside and outside of your industry, knows exactly who you are and what you’re about. Canva

Creating eye-catching visuals is an essential part of creating a strong personal brand, and Canva makes it easy to do just that. This online design platform offers hundreds of templates for everything from posters and brochures to business cards, logos, and more. The drag-and-drop interface is incredibly simple to use, and there’s an extensive library of images, icons, fonts, and illustrations to choose from. Plus, you can easily add your own branded elements like logos or colors to ensure everything looks professional and on-brand, regardless of the design you’re creating. Hootsuite

Social media is a great way to get your name out there and promote your personal brand. But managing multiple accounts on different platforms can be time-consuming and overwhelming, which is why so many people turn to Hootsuite. Hootsuite is a powerful social media management tool that enables you to monitor conversations, schedule posts, and analyze performance across multiple platforms from one convenient dashboard. It also allows you to quickly respond to messages and comments, ensuring that your personal brand is always being seen in the best light. Not only does Hootsuite save you time, but it also helps to keep your content consistent across all platforms and makes sure no opportunities are missed.

Medium

While it’s not strictly a personal branding tool, Medium is a great platform for writing and publishing content to establish authority in your industry. For those unaware, Medium essentially functions as a hybrid blog-social media platform, allowing content creators to publish articles in order to attract readers and potential customers. By publishing thoughtful pieces on Medium, you can gain exposure for yourself and your brand, as well as build up a following of loyal readers who will become invested in your story. Plus, with its easy-to-use interface and in-depth analytics, you can track the performance of your content and see how it’s resonating with readers. Medium is also a great way to drive traffic to your website or other social media channels, further strengthening your personal brand and giving you more opportunities to engage with people.
